    Hi Moms! Need a tip for our upcoming late Nov. trip. Trying to decide between O'Hana dinner or Sci-Fi Cafe dinner. We've eaten at O'Hana on our last trip, but for breakfast. Going with DH and DS12. We'll be on the regular dining plan. Thank you!

    Hello, Beth,

    When we begin planning a trip to WDW, my sons always remind me to make reservations at Sci-Fi Dine-In Theater.  They have loved it since they were young children and still as teenagers continue to like the campy atmosphere and kitsch.  And I have to confess, I enjoy it as well for the atmosphere; it is so clever and witty. 

    Don't get me wrong, 'Ohana is also enjoyable with lots of eat and the chance of watching Wishes while dining, but I'm partial to Sci-Fi Dine-In Theater and the chance to get nostalgic with my family.  Eating there has actually brought about many fun conversations about the ways things were for us parents when we were growing up compared to our children's childhood.  

    You may also enjoy a recent blog at the Disney Parks Blog about a family who has dined at Sci-Fi Dine-In weekly for the last two years!

    Regardless of where you choose to eat, you'll be having dinner while at Walt Disney World!  I don't think you can go wrong either way.
